/// <summary> /// Handles the GotFocus event of the DevExpressControl control. /// </summary> /// <param name="sender">The source of the event.</param> /// <param name="e">The <see cref="System.EventArgs"/> instance containing the event data.</param> private void DevExpressControl_GotFocus(object sender, EventArgs e) { var control = sender as Control; if (control != null) { DevExpressErrorProvider.SetError(control, string.Empty); } }
/// <summary> /// Handles the error dev express controls. /// </summary> /// <param name="errorCode">The error code.</param> /// <param name="message">The message.</param> private void HandleErrorDevExpressControls(ErrorCode errorCode, string message) { if (ErrorDictonaryDevExpress.ContainsKey(errorCode)) { TurnOnErrorHandledStatus(); var control = ErrorDictonaryDevExpress[errorCode]; DevExpressErrorProvider.SetError(control, message.ToUpper()); DevExpressErrorProvider.SetIconAlignment(control, ErrorIconAlignment.MiddleRight); DevExpressErrorProvider.SetErrorType(control, ErrorType.Critical); } }